Twenty-First Century Electrical Catalog Anime Premieres July 2026 — Koki Uchiyama & Daisuke Ono Join KyoAni Cast
Kyoto Animation's latest masterpiece—the television anime 《Twenty First Century Electrical Catalog-Eureka Evrica》 is confirmed to begin airing in July 2026. The official team today formally announced the second wave of additional voice actor cast. This work, adapted from Hiroshi Yuki's light novel of the same name, has been highly anticipated by anime fans worldwide since its animation announcement. The newly revealed lineup includes powerhouse voice actors such as Koki Uchiyama, Daisuke Ono, Shunsuke Takeuchi, and Minako Kotobuki.
They will inject even more highlights into this Meiji-era electrical adventure.
Additional Voice Actor Cast Revealed: Four Powerhouse Actors Portray Key Roles
On February 13th, the official team unveiled the voice actors for four characters crucial to the plot's development. These characters revolve around the male and female protagonists—Kihachi Sakamoto and Inako Momokawa—deeply influencing the journey to find the "Electrical Catalog".

Yosuke Mizoe — Voiced by: Koki Uchiyama
The young master of the "Mizoe Store", who amassed a vast fortune through steam engines. He exhibits an abnormal and unsettling obsession with the legendary "Twenty First Century Electrical Catalog". How Koki Uchiyama will portray this wealthy young master, who opposes or competes with the main characters, using his calm and mysterious voice, is highly anticipated.

Seiroku Sakamoto — Voiced by: Daisuke Ono
The older brother of the male protagonist Kihachi, he is a charismatic genius inventor who pours boundless passion into electrical inventions. While captivating in the eyes of many, he left for the battlefield and never returned, becoming one of the greatest mysteries in the work. Daisuke Ono's mature and steady acting skills are expected to perfectly portray this key figure who exists in memories and legends.

Kengo Kuga — Voiced by: Shunsuke Takeuchi
A former soldier possessing a physique and monstrous strength as tough as a steam locomotive, he is also the fiancé of Noriko, the older sister of Inako Momokawa. Shunsuke Takeuchi's deep and solid voice perfectly matches the image of this powerful character.

Noriko Momokawa — Voiced by: Minako Kotobuki
The older sister of the female protagonist Inako, and also the fiancée of Kengo Kuga. She is strong-willed, capable, shrewd, and skilled in martial arts, playing the role of a reliable pillar in the Momokawa family. Story Synopsis: A Meiji Kyoto Adventure Interwoven with Steam and Electricity
The stage for 《Twenty First Century Electrical Catalog》 is set in early 20th century (Meiji era) Kyoto—a period of intense collision between the old and new eras. Traditional beliefs, advanced steam engines, and the "electrical" civilization about to change the world converge here.
The story follows a girl, Inako Momokawa, from a sake-brewing family who faces constant misfortune and can only find solace in gods and buddhas. She meets a boy, Kihachi Sakamoto, who denies gods and buddhas and firmly believes the "Age of Electricity" is coming. For their own reasons—searching for a mysterious book that predicts the future, the "Electrical Catalog", and escaping an unwanted marriage—the two embark on an adventurous journey spanning Kyoto and Shiga.
Kyoto Animation's Top-Tier Production Team
This work is produced by Kyoto Animation, showcasing the company's signature meticulous art style and detailed research on Kyoto's landscapes:
- Original Work: Hiroshi Yuki
- Director: Minoru Ota
- Series Composition: Tatsuhiko Urahata
- Character Design / Chief Animation Director: Kohei Okamura
- Worldview Setting: Takaaki Suzuki
- Music: Hitomi Koto
